A fan sprinted onto — and most of the way across — the Citi Field outfield Saturday night, causing a brief delay during the Mets’ 3-2 comeback win over the Blue Jays before a security guard decked him.

The fan, wearing a dark shirt, long pants and dark sneakers, started in left field and sprinted all the way across to the right-center area during the bottom of the fifth.

He stopped, pumped his arms into the air to fire up the crowd and then ran all the way back to left field before stopping.

As a group of security guards approached, one tackled him to the ground as the rest surrounded the fan, and they escorted him off the field as fans cheered.

The fan didn’t make contact with any of the three Toronto outfielders.
